Production Operator – Permanent Role

Hours: 40 hours per week (8:00am – 4:30pm, Monday to Friday)  Contract: Permanent

Be Part of a Team That Keeps Things Moving!

We’re looking for a Production Operator to join our client'sgrowing team. This is a hands‑on role where you’ll play a key part in ensuring products are processed accurately, efficiently, and to the highest standards. If you’re detail-oriented, proactive, and enjoy working in a fast‑paced environment, we’d love to hear from you.

What You’ll Do
  • Operate and monitor production processes to ensure smooth workflow.
  • Follow all training and work instructions precisely.
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ized workspace.
  • Prepare products for quality checks and final packaging.
  • Inspect items to ensure they meet company standards and reject non‑conforming products.
  • Complete sterilization and final checks before dispatch.
  • Support the Goods In to Goods Out process for seamless operations.
  • Adhere to all Health & Safety policies.
What We’re Looking For
  • Strong att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Previous experience in a production or operational environment.
  • Comfortable using Microsoft Windows and Office Suite.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Customer‑focused mindset with a commitment to excellence.
Education & Qualifications
  • GCSE in English and Maths.
  • BTec or NVQ qualifications are desirable.
